Output f61b4ce953abe2b1dbfbfa8baf941238056bdff975b3257a3aff3fcbd6f95401:0

value
21706904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db507b94af0efa6ee56e35bc34388ff6ae708ce5 OP_EQUAL
address
3MgeKbMx5srDDi76T1jE2NLQgQLexQunzX
transaction
f61b4ce953abe2b1dbfbfa8baf941238056bdff975b3257a3aff3fcbd6f95401
spent
true